**Q: SpoolPilot jobs stuck in QUEUED after deploy — block the release?**

A: Usually no. The spooler drains queued jobs within two minutes of restart. Check the drain gauge first. If jobs sit longer than five minutes, the Fennwick print gateway likely rejected the handshake; roll back the gateway config, not the service. Releases only block if the dead-letter count climbs. Retries are automatic; manual requeue is a last resort. For unresolved stuck queues, raise it with the spooler team at the address below.

escalation mailbox, yafog-kafof: eliok@xolmarcloud.local

Handover: Quorrel broker upgrade (for eng sync)

Hey all — passing the Quorrel 4.x upgrade to Dasha's team. Staging is done; prod brokers on the Wickfield cluster are still on 3.9. Consumer lag stayed flat during the staging cutover, so no schema surprises expected. One gotcha: the upgrade tool locks the admin console mid-migration. If that happens, regain access with the recovery passphrase below.

unlock words, fadug-tageg: zorix-wenwyn-quenmir

# Break-Glass: Catalog Cache Invalidation

Scope: the Pinrow product catalog at Veldstone Retail. If stale prices persist after a purge and the Hollowmere invalidation queue is wedged, use break-glass to flush the edge tier directly. Contractors: get verbal sign-off from the catalog lead first. Steps: open the Hollowmere admin shell, select emergency-flush, confirm the tenant, and run it once — repeated flushes thrash the origin. Access is logged and expires after 20 minutes. Unseal the admin shell with the passphrase below.

recovery phrase for kahop-tajog: istix-casvan

Hello plugin authors,

The Marqdown rendering pipeline now normalizes AST nodes before your transform hooks run, so extensions targeting raw HTML passthrough must declare the new capability flag. Rendering output for tables and footnotes is unchanged. Sandboxed preview builds are available on the Fennel staging tier through Friday. Please re-run your conformance suites against the staged artifacts and report regressions in the usual tracker. Compatibility testing should reference the build identified below.

pipeline stamp: htk31_f769b577b3028a4e9958e5bb8d1259a